The Complete Guide To Archival Boxes

Archival boxes are an essential tool for preserving and protecting valuable and delicate items such as documents, photographs, and artifacts. These specialized boxes are designed to provide a secure environment that helps prevent damage from environmental factors, pests, and mishandling. In this article, we will discuss the different types of archival boxes available, their uses, and tips for choosing the right one for your needs.

Types of archival boxes

There are several types of archival boxes designed to suit different purposes and items. The most common types include:

1. Document Boxes: Document boxes are ideal for storing, organizing, and protecting important papers, letters, and manuscripts. These boxes are usually made of acid-free and lignin-free materials to prevent deterioration and discoloration of the documents inside.

2. Photo Boxes: Photo boxes are specially designed to store and protect photographs, negatives, and slides. These boxes are typically made of acid-free and lignin-free paper or board to ensure the preservation of the images for an extended period.

3. Artifact Boxes: Artifact boxes are used to safeguard three-dimensional objects such as textiles, ceramics, and small artifacts. These boxes are made of sturdy and acid-free materials to protect the items from dust, light, and fluctuations in temperature and humidity.

4. Oversized Boxes: Oversized boxes are larger than standard archival boxes and are ideal for storing large documents, posters, maps, and other oversized items. These boxes are available in various sizes to accommodate different types of oversized materials.

Uses of archival boxes

Archival boxes are commonly used by archives, libraries, museums, and collectors to protect and preserve valuable items. Some of the most common uses of archival boxes include:

1. Preservation: Archival boxes help prevent damage to delicate and fragile items by providing a safe and stable environment. The acid-free and lignin-free materials used in these boxes protect items from deterioration, yellowing, and fading.

2. Storage: Archival boxes are used to store and organize items in a systematic and efficient manner. By keeping items in archival boxes, they are easily accessible and protected from external threats such as dust, light, and pests.

3. Display: Archival boxes can also be used for displaying items such as photographs, documents, and artifacts. By using specially designed display boxes, items can be showcased while still being protected from environmental factors.

4. Transportation: Archival boxes are often used to transport items from one location to another safely. These boxes provide a secure and protective environment during transit, reducing the risk of damage or loss.

Tips for Choosing the Right Archival Box

When choosing an archival box for your needs, there are several factors to consider to ensure the proper protection and preservation of your items. Here are some tips for selecting the right archival box:

1. Size: Choose an archival box that is the right size for the item you want to store or protect. The box should provide enough room for the item to fit comfortably without being too loose or too tight.

2. Material: Look for archival boxes made of acid-free and lignin-free materials to ensure the long-term preservation of your items. These materials are non-reactive and will not damage or degrade the items stored inside.

3. Construction: Consider the construction of the archival box, including the durability of the materials and the design of the box. A well-constructed box will provide adequate protection and support for the items stored inside.

4. Closure: Choose an archival box with a secure closure, such as a clamshell design or a sturdy lid, to keep items safe and protected from dust and light.

Understanding The Importance Of Cryo Freezer Temperature

Cryo freezers play a crucial role in preserving biological samples for research, medical treatments, and various other applications. Maintaining the correct temperature inside a cryo freezer is essential to prevent samples from degrading and ensuring their viability for future use. In this article, we will discuss the significance of cryo freezer temperature and its impact on stored samples.

Cryo freezers are designed to operate at ultra-low temperatures, typically ranging from -80°C to as low as -196°C. These extremely low temperatures are necessary to slow down biological processes and inhibit degradation of sensitive samples. Different types of samples require specific temperature settings to ensure their long-term preservation and viability.

For instance, cells, tissues, DNA, and other biological materials are often stored in cryo freezers for research purposes. These samples are highly susceptible to temperature fluctuations, which can lead to cellular damage and loss of viability. Therefore, maintaining a stable and accurate temperature inside the cryo freezer is crucial for preserving the integrity of these samples.

One of the key factors that influence cryo freezer temperature is the insulation and design of the freezer itself. Cryo freezers are typically equipped with multiple layers of insulation and sophisticated cooling systems to maintain a constant temperature throughout the storage space. It is essential to monitor and regulate the temperature settings regularly to ensure that samples remain at the desired temperature range.

Temperature fluctuations inside the cryo freezer can have detrimental effects on the stored samples. For example, if the temperature rises above the recommended range, ice crystals may form in the samples, causing cellular damage and reducing their viability. On the other hand, excessively low temperatures can lead to sample dehydration and denaturation, compromising the quality of the stored material.

To prevent such issues, cryo freezers are equipped with temperature monitoring and alarm systems that alert users to any deviations from the set temperature range. Regular calibration and maintenance of the freezer are also essential to ensure that it operates correctly and maintains the desired temperature consistently.

Moreover, the type of storage containers used in the cryo freezer can also affect temperature distribution and stability. Properly designed storage containers can help maintain a uniform temperature throughout the freezer and prevent temperature gradients that may lead to sample degradation. It is essential to use high-quality containers that are compatible with the cryo freezer and provide adequate thermal insulation for the stored samples.

In addition to temperature control, humidity levels inside the cryo freezer also play a significant role in sample preservation. High humidity levels can lead to ice buildup and frost formation, affecting the temperature stability and compromising the integrity of the samples. Proper ventilation and circulation of air inside the freezer are essential to maintain optimal humidity levels and prevent condensation.

The importance of cryo freezer temperature becomes even more pronounced when dealing with valuable or irreplaceable samples, such as patient samples for medical diagnosis or rare genetic material for research. Any fluctuations in temperature can result in irreversible damage to these samples, leading to loss of valuable data and research opportunities.

Understanding The Difference: Compounding Aseptic Isolator Vs Compounding Aseptic Containment Isolator

In the pharmaceutical industry, the safety and quality of compounded medications are of utmost importance To ensure the integrity of sterile preparations, pharmacies and healthcare facilities utilize various types of isolators Two commonly used isolators are compounding aseptic isolators (CAIs) and compounding aseptic containment isolators (CACIs) While both serve the same purpose of protecting the product from contamination during compounding processes, there are key differences between the two systems.

Compounding Aseptic Isolator (CAI):
A compounding aseptic isolator, also known as a barrier isolator, is a device that provides an ISO 5 environment to protect sterile products during compounding The CAI is a sealed unit with a single HEPA filter that provides a class 100 environment within the workspace This means that the air inside the isolator contains less than 100 particles greater than 0.5 microns in size per cubic foot.

The CAI is commonly used for low-risk level compounding activities, such as reconstituting medications, transferring sterile products, and preparing simple admixtures It is designed to maintain sterility by preventing contaminants from entering the workspace The operator inserts their hands through gloves attached to the front of the isolator to manipulate the components inside while maintaining a sterile environment.

Compounding Aseptic Containment Isolator (CACI):
A compounding aseptic containment isolator, on the other hand, is a more advanced system that provides a higher level of containment for compounding hazardous drugs or preparations that pose a higher risk of contamination The CACI is a sealed unit that offers a higher level of protection by providing an ISO 5 environment along with additional features to prevent the escape of hazardous substances.

The CACI is equipped with a double HEPA filter system, as well as a unique airflow pattern that ensures a unidirectional flow of air to maintain sterility compounding aseptic isolator vs compounding aseptic containment isolator. In addition to gloves for manual manipulation, the CACI may also have airlocks or pass-through chambers for transferring materials in and out of the isolator without compromising the integrity of the containment.

Differences Between CAI and CACI:
One of the main differences between a compounding aseptic isolator and a compounding aseptic containment isolator is the level of containment they provide While both systems offer a sterile environment for compounding medications, the CACI offers a higher level of protection for handling hazardous substances This makes the CACI the preferred choice for compounding cytotoxic drugs, chemotherapy agents, and other high-risk preparations.

Another key difference is the design and features of the isolators A CACI is typically larger and more complex than a CAI due to the additional features required for containment This includes specialized air handling systems, airlocks, and pass-through chambers to ensure that hazardous materials are safely contained within the isolator.

When considering which type of isolator to use, it is important to assess the risk level of the compounding activities being performed Low-risk level compounding may be suitable for a CAI, while high-risk level compounding would require a CACI to ensure the safety of the operator and the quality of the compounded medications.

Understanding The Accelerated Possession Defence Form

When it comes to renting a property, there are various legal procedures that both landlords and tenants must follow to ensure that everything is done in a fair and lawful manner. One such procedure is the accelerated possession procedure, which allows landlords to regain possession of their property without having to attend a court hearing. However, tenants have the right to defend themselves using an accelerated possession defence form.

The accelerated possession procedure is commonly used by landlords to regain possession of their property quickly and efficiently. This procedure is typically used when a tenant has failed to pay rent, has breached the terms of the tenancy agreement, or the fixed term of the tenancy has come to an end. In such cases, the landlord can serve a Section 21 notice to the tenant, giving them a minimum of two months’ notice to vacate the property.

Once the notice period has expired, the landlord can apply to the court for an accelerated possession order. This order allows the landlord to regain possession of the property without having to attend a court hearing, provided that the correct procedures have been followed. However, tenants have the right to defend themselves by submitting an accelerated possession defence form to the court.

The accelerated possession defence form allows tenants to outline their reasons for contesting the landlord’s application for possession. Common reasons for defending an accelerated possession order include disputes over the validity of the Section 21 notice, allegations of unfair eviction, or claims of disrepair in the property. Tenants must provide evidence to support their case, such as correspondence with the landlord, witness statements, or photographs of the property.

It is important for tenants to carefully consider their grounds for defence before submitting the accelerated possession defence form. The court will consider the merits of the tenant’s case and may decide to hold a hearing if it believes that there are valid reasons for contesting the landlord’s application. If the court finds in favor of the tenant, the accelerated possession order may be set aside, and the tenant may be granted more time to vacate the property.

In some cases, tenants may also be able to request an extension to the possession order if they can demonstrate that they are taking steps to address any issues raised by the landlord. For example, if a tenant has fallen behind on rent payments, they may be able to negotiate a repayment plan with the landlord to avoid eviction. Similarly, if there are issues of disrepair in the property, tenants can request that the landlord carries out the necessary repairs before seeking possession.

The Ultimate Guide To Van Top Tents: Everything You Need To Know

If you’re an avid camper or outdoor enthusiast looking to take your adventures to the next level, a van top tent may be just what you need. These innovative tents offer a unique camping experience that combines the convenience of a traditional tent with the added comfort and security of being elevated off the ground. In this comprehensive guide, we’ll cover everything you need to know about van top tents, from their benefits and features to how to choose the right one for your needs.

van top tent have gained popularity in recent years as an alternative to traditional ground tents. They are designed to be mounted on the roof of a van or SUV, providing a comfortable and secure sleeping area that is off the ground and protected from the elements. Van top tents come in a variety of styles and sizes, from compact two-person tents to larger models that can accommodate up to four people. Some even come with built-in amenities like awnings, windows, and extra storage space.

One of the main benefits of using a van top tent is that it allows you to camp in places where traditional tents cannot go. Because the tent is mounted on the roof of your vehicle, you can easily set up camp on uneven or rocky terrain, or in areas where the ground is wet or muddy. This makes van top tents ideal for off-road camping, beach camping, or any other outdoor adventure where finding a flat and dry spot to pitch a tent may be a challenge.

Another advantage of van top tents is that they provide an added layer of security and protection from wildlife and inclement weather. When you’re elevated off the ground, you don’t have to worry about creepy crawlies or critters making their way into your tent while you sleep. Additionally, being on the roof of your vehicle protects you from ground moisture and flooding, keeping you dry and comfortable in rainy conditions.

When choosing a van top tent, there are a few key factors to consider. First and foremost, you’ll want to make sure that the tent is compatible with your vehicle. Most van top tents are designed to fit on standard roof racks or crossbars, but it’s important to check the specifications to ensure a proper fit. You’ll also want to consider the size and capacity of the tent, as well as any additional features like windows, ventilation, and storage pockets.

Some popular brands of van top tents include Tepui, Yakima, and Roofnest, each offering a range of models to suit different needs and budgets. Tepui is known for its high-quality materials and durable construction, making their tents a favorite among serious campers and overlanders. Yakima offers a more budget-friendly option with their Skyrise series, which still provides excellent comfort and protection for camping adventures. Roofnest specializes in hardshell tents that pop up and fold down with ease, making them a great choice for quick and easy setup.

Once you’ve chosen the right van top tent for your needs, it’s important to properly install and maintain it to ensure a safe and enjoyable camping experience. Make s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for mounting the tent on your vehicle, and regularly check for any signs of wear or damage. It’s also a good idea to invest in a quality mattress or sleeping pad to maximize comfort while sleeping in your van top tent.

The Ultimate Guide To Choosing The Best Long Window Cleaning Pole

Keeping your windows clean and streak-free can be quite a challenge, especially when they are located in hard-to-reach areas. This is where a long window cleaning pole comes in handy. With the right tool, you can easily reach high windows, skylights, and other elevated surfaces without having to risk your safety by climbing a ladder.

When it comes to choosing a long window cleaning pole, there are several factors to consider to ensure that you get the best one for your needs. In this guide, we will discuss the different types of long window cleaning poles available on the market and provide tips on how to choose the right one for you.

Types of long window cleaning poles

There are several types of long window cleaning poles available, each designed for different purposes. The most common types include:

1. Telescopic Poles: Telescopic poles are adjustable in length, allowing you to extend or retract the pole as needed. This makes them ideal for reaching windows at different heights without having to switch between multiple poles. Telescopic poles are often made of lightweight materials such as aluminum or fiberglass, making them easy to handle and maneuver.

2. Extension Poles: Extension poles are fixed in length and cannot be adjusted. They are typically used for reaching windows that are a specific distance away from the ground, such as second-story windows. Extension poles are available in various lengths, so be sure to choose one that will reach the windows you need to clean.

3. Water-Fed Poles: Water-fed poles are equipped with a water-fed system that allows you to clean windows without having to use a bucket of water. The pole is connected to a hose and a water source, which provides a steady stream of water to help rinse away dirt and grime. Water-fed poles are great for cleaning windows on tall buildings or hard-to-reach areas.

Tips for Choosing the Right long window cleaning pole

When choosing a long window cleaning pole, there are several factors to consider to ensure that you get the best one for your needs. Here are some tips to help you make the right decision:

1. Length: Consider the height of the windows you need to clean and choose a pole that will reach them comfortably. Telescopic poles are adjustable in length, while extension poles come in fixed lengths, so be sure to choose the right size for your needs.

2. Material: Long window cleaning poles are often made of lightweight materials such as aluminum, fiberglass, or carbon fiber. Consider the weight of the pole and how easy it will be to handle while cleaning. Aluminum poles are lightweight and durable, while fiberglass poles are flexible and resistant to corrosion.

3. Attachments: Some long window cleaning poles come with attachments such as squeegees, scrub brushes, and extension hoses. Consider the attachments you will need to clean your windows effectively and choose a pole that is compatible with them.

4. Price: Long window cleaning poles come in a wide range of prices, so consider your budget when choosing a pole. Remember that a high-quality pole may cost more upfront but will last longer and provide better results in the long run.

5. Brand: Choose a reputable brand that is known for producing high-quality window cleaning poles. Do some research and read reviews to find a brand that has a good reputation for durability and performance.
